Is Belvidere or New York City Safer?

According to crimebycity.com's analysis of 2024 FBI data, Belvidere is safer than New York City (Safety Score 89/100 vs 19/100), with a total crime rate of 593 per 100,000 versus 3,040 for New York City — 80% lower. Belvidere has lower rates in 7 of 7 crime categories.

The biggest difference is in murder, where Belvidere has a 100% lower rate.

Note: New York City is 328.0x larger by coverage, which can affect crime rate comparisons. Larger cities tend to report higher rates due to density and more comprehensive reporting.

Detailed Crime Rate Comparison

Crime Type Belvidere New York City Difference
Total Crime Rate 592.8 3,039.7 -2,446.9
Violent Crime Rate 154.1 671.4 -517.3
Murder Rate 0.0 3.9 -3.9
Rape Rate 27.7 23.4 +4.3
Robbery Rate 15.8 187.5 -171.7
Aggravated Assault Rate 106.7 456.2 -349.5
Property Crime Rate 438.7 2,368.3 -1,929.6
Burglary Rate 110.7 154.7 -44.1
Larceny-Theft Rate 276.7 2,015.0 -1,738.3
Motor Vehicle Theft Rate 51.4 198.5 -147.2

All rates per 100,000 residents. Source: FBI UCR 2024.

About Belvidere, IL

Belvidere, Illinois, the "City of Murals," sits along the Kishwaukee River in Boone County. This former agricultural hub is home to a significant Hispanic population and a large Chrysler assembly plant. With a safety score of 89/100 and a population coverage of 25,302, Belvidere has a total crime rate of 592.8 per 100,000 residents.

About New York City, NY

New York City, a global financial hub, sits at the mouth of the Hudson River. Home to the iconic Statue of Liberty, its five boroughs house over 8 million people, making it the most populous city in the United States. With a safety score of 19/100 and a population coverage of 8,299,271, New York City has a total crime rate of 3,039.7 per 100,000 residents.
